Effect of diallyl disulfide on human gastric carcinoma MGC803 cells proliferation through blockage in G_2/M phase

Jin Lin

Open publisher page 0 citations

Abstract

Objective To study the effect of diallyl disulfide(DADS) on human gastric carcinoma MGC803 cells proliferation through blockage in G2/M phase. Methods Inhibition of DADS on MGC803 cells proliferation was measured by MTT assay. The effect of DADS on MGC803 cell cycle was detected by flow cytometry. Results Inhibition ratio of DADS of 30mg/L, 60mg/L and 90mg/L on MGC803 cells were 31.58%±2.20%, 53.87%±4.50%, 81.58%±1.7%,respectively. With the increase of DADS concentration, the rate of G0/G1 phase cells was decreased, while the rate of G2/M phase cells was increased. Condusion DADS can inhibit the proliferation of human gastric carcinoma MGC803 cells, through the blockage of G2/M phase and inhibition of cell division.
